Crystal Palace vs Manchester City Predictions
Palace and City have kept recent meetings high-scoring
Each of the last six Premier League meetings between Crystal Palace and Manchester City has produced at least three goals. Recent editions of this fixture have therefore provided a strong scoring reference.
City's league matches averaged just under three goals last season, while Palace's averaged 2.4. The hosts also scored in five of their final six home matches last season across all competitions.
Palace drew a blank in their 2-0 defeat at Everton last weekend, although they were unfortunate not to score. City conceded just over one goal per Premier League away game on average last season, and their defence has also allowed four goals across two matches this season.
City have plenty of scoring evidence of their own. Both league meetings with Palace last season finished 3-0, so they have already shown they can reach the required total themselves.
Manchester City are 1.57 to win, but there is less appeal in that result price. With all six recent league meetings producing at least three goals, I’m backing Over 2.5 Match Goals at 1.67.

City can hit three again despite defensive doubts
Manchester City won both Premier League meetings with Crystal Palace 3-0 last season. They also began Enzo Maresca's Premier League spell with a 2-1 comeback victory over Bournemouth.
Palace's first league match under Pierre Sage ended in a 2-0 defeat at Everton. The Eagles were unfortunate to draw a blank, however, which keeps a single Palace goal firmly within the scoring profile behind this prediction.
City should probably have scored more than twice against Bournemouth after missing several good chances. Former Palace man Marc Guehi scored in that victory after earlier wasting a good opportunity, while he also registered two shots in the most recent league meeting between these sides.
There is a defensive limitation for City. They have conceded four goals in two matches this season, following a 3-0 Community Shield defeat to Arsenal with the 2-1 Bournemouth win, and they have looked vulnerable after Rodri's exit. City's forwards have yet to hit their stride, but the team still scored twice in their league opener.
City scored exactly three times in both league meetings with Palace last season, and Manchester City 3-1 could be worth a look at 13.00.
